    The district heating system can use heat sources impractical to deploy to individual homes, such as heavy oil, wood byproducts, or nuclear fission. The distribution network is more costly to build than for gas or electric heating, and so is only found in densely populated areas or compact communities.

    An example of one of the several kinds of STES illustrates well the capability of interseasonal heat storage. In Alberta, Canada, the homes of the Drake Landing Solar Community (in operation since 2007), get 97% of their year-round heat from a district heat system that is supplied by solar heat from solar-thermal panels on garage roofs.
